RADIOHEAD HAVE A NEW SONG! AND IT’S… oh, forget it! This song has been heard over 16 million times on YouTube, the new album has now been out for a month or so now, and it’s no longer trending, or in vogue or whatever the heck you crazy kids call it! Regardless of my tardiness, this is an amazing song that many people more intelligent and sophisticated than I have harped on about already, but I simply cannot get enough of those pizzicato strings, or the wonderful contrast between the more serene verses and the twisted chorus. Bravo, good sirs of Radiohead!